Types of mobile devices for Internet access
The first thing you need to decide is the device's form factor. The market offers two main classes of hardware, each with its own target audience. Understanding the differences between them will help you avoid overpaying for unnecessary features or, conversely, buying a device that's too weak.
Portable routers, often referred to as MiFiThese are compact gadgets about the size of a credit card or power bank. They run on a built-in battery, making them ideal for travel. These devices create a local wireless network that can be connected to a smartphone, tablet, or laptop. However, their antenna power is limited by the size of the device.
Stationary 4G/5G routers are bulkier devices that require a power connection. They are equipped with full-fledged external antennas (often removable), providing significantly improved signal reception even in areas with poor coverage. This class of devices is best considered for permanent use in the home or office.
- 📱 Portable routers: Autonomy, compactness, convenience for travel, but weaker signal.
- 🏠 Stationary routers: powerful signal, LAN ports, external antenna support, and power supply from a wall outlet.
- 💻 USB modems: The most budget-friendly option, they require a connection to a PC and often do not have their own Wi-Fi module.
⚠️ Attention: Some USB modems can only function as Wi-Fi routers when connected to a computer with the network sharing mode configured, but this creates an unnecessary load on the PC and reduces the stability of the connection.
Selection criteria: from communication standards to ports
When choosing a specific model, it's important to pay attention to the technical specifications, which directly impact connection speed and stability. Not all modems are created equal, and marketing slogans often obscure the hardware's true capabilities.
The key parameter is support for communication standards. If you are in the city, most likely, you will be satisfied with LTE (4G) Cat4 or Cat6. However, for rural use or areas with poor coverage, it's worth looking at models that support frequency aggregation and, if your budget allows, standard 5GAggregation allows combining multiple frequency ranges to increase channel capacity.
External antenna connectors are also critical. Even if you're buying a device for future use, the ability to connect a directional antenna can be a lifesaver when the operator changes towers or builds new buildings that block the signal. In fixed models, look for connectors like TS9 or SMA.
- 📡 LTE Category: Cat4 (up to 150 Mbps), Cat6 (up to 300 Mbps), Cat12 and higher (up to 1 Gbps).
- 🔌 Interfaces: The presence of a LAN port will allow you to connect a TV set-top box or a desktop PC using a cable.
- 📶 Antennas: The presence of external connectors (SMA/TS9) is critical for summer cottages and villages.

Signal setup and optimization
After purchasing a device, it needs to be configured correctly. Often, users simply insert a SIM card and use the default settings, unaware that they can significantly increase their speed. The first step should always be to manually check the signal strength in the router's web interface.
Log into your device's control panel, usually accessible at 192.168.8.1 or 192.168.0.1Find the section that displays the signal level (RSRP, SINR, RSRQ). RSRP shows the signal strength (the closer to 0, the better, for example -80 dBm is better than -110 dBm), and SINR — signal quality (signal-to-noise ratio). A high SINR is critical for high speed.
If your results are low, try experimenting with the modem's location. Raise it higher, move it closer to a window, or point it in a different direction. For stationary models with external antennas, accurately pointing the antenna toward the operator's base station can increase speed by 2-3 times.

Compatibility issues and unlocking
A common issue users encounter is modem locking to a specific carrier. If you purchased your device from a carrier (e.g., MTS, Beeline, or Megafon), it will likely only work with SIM cards from that carrier. This is a software limitation that can be overcome.
The unlocking process can be paid or free, simple or complex, depending on the model. For some devices, simply entering a special unlock code generated based on the modem's IMEI code is sufficient. Others require reflashing the firmware or using specialized software.
Purchasing an unlocked device immediately eliminates these hassles. These modems are usually more expensive, but they allow you to switch carriers depending on coverage in your area, which is especially important for travelers.
- 🔓 Lock: The device is locked to one operator.
- 🌍 Unlock: The device works with any SIM cards.
- 💳 IMEI: a unique identifier required to generate the unlock code.
FAQ: Frequently Asked Questions
Is it possible to use a regular USB modem as a Wi-Fi router?
Yes, but with limitations. Some USB modems (for example, the Huawei E3372) have a built-in "HiLink" feature, which creates a virtual Wi-Fi network on the connected computer. However, for full functionality without a PC, special USB modem models with a built-in battery or a standalone modem are required.
Does Wi-Fi speed affect mobile internet speed?
Wi-Fi speeds within a local network (between the modem and your laptop) are usually higher than the data transfer speeds from the carrier's tower. Therefore, the bottleneck is almost always the 3G/4G/5G channel, not the router's Wi-Fi module, unless it's very old.
Do I need to buy an external antenna for my 4G modem?
It depends on the signal strength at your location. If the modem indicator shows 1-2 bars and the speed is low, an antenna is necessary. If the signal is strong but the speed drops in the evening due to tower load, an antenna may help little or not at all.
Is it safe to buy used modems?
Buying used modems is possible, but there's a risk of getting a device with a blocked IMEI (blacklisted) or a faulty battery (in the case of MiFi routers). Be sure to check the IMEI using specialized services before purchasing.
